    Game » consists of 14 releases. Released Feb 17, 2011

    The first game developed by Atlus for the PS3/Xbox 360. Made by the Persona Team, The game is an "adult oriented" action-adventure/horror game with puzzle platforming stages.

    According to a Cake, Catherine Sold 200,000 Units its First Week

    Sex is not really all that successful for games. The amount of nudity in this game is comparable to Mass Effect. People are just misled by the cover and marketing, and think the game is catered toward, well, perverts. It's something completely new to the gaming market and the game itself provides a very mature topic and the theme is definitely common in everyday life. I don't recall another a Japanese title with suggestive covers ever selling well. If more than anything, Catherine sold well because of the Atlus fanbase, actual marketing (unlike EA), and reviews.
